Abstract

The invention discloses a light composite wallboard forming mold. The forming mold comprises a base (1), a bottom surface mold plate (2), a front side mold plate assembly (3), a rear side mold plate assembly (4), a left side mold plate assembly (5), a right side mold plate assembly (6) and positioning and locking devices (7) which correspondingly cooperate with the left end and the right end of the front side mold plate assembly (3) and the left end and the right end of the rear side mold plate assembly (4), wherein the front side mold plate assembly (3) and the rear side mold plate assembly (4) are symmetrical and are consistent in structure, and the left side mold plate assembly (5) and the right side mold plate assembly (6) are symmetrical and are consistent in structure. According to the light composite wallboard forming mold, the left side mold plate assembly (5) and the right side mold plate assembly (6) can rotate to be opened and can adjust the length of a formed light composite wallboard through change of the bottom surface mold plate (2) with the different length, and moreover, the thickness of the formed light composite wallboard can be adjusted, so that production of the light composite wallboards with different specifications can be met, production efficiency is high, the product quality is good, and the mold is particularly suitable for being used in an automaticproduction line.

technical field [0001] The invention relates to a light-duty composite wallboard molding die, such as a molding die used in an automatic production line for PC light-duty composite wallboards. Background technique [0002] The molding and manufacturing of light composite wallboards for buildings in the prior art, such as the molding and manufacturing of PC light composite wallboards, are all made by hand with moulds, and the molding groove molds are completely fixed concave grooves made according to the size of the light composite wallboards. Groove molds, one mold and one size, to produce light composite wallboards of different lengths and thicknesses, it is necessary to manufacture corresponding groove molds of various specifications and sizes.
